Corpay is currently looking to hire a Business Analyst within our International Vehicle Payments Technology landscape. This position is located in Meriden In this role, you will drive end‑to‑end process excellence across the International Vehicle Payments Technology landscape. You will act as a strategic partner to Technology and Business leadership, identifying, analyzing, and transforming operational processes to enhance efficiency, reduce risk, and increase commercial value.
You will report directly to the VP, IT Performance, and regularly collaborate with International Vehicle Payments Technology Leadership, Product Leadership, and Business Stakeholders.

Role Responsibilities
Process Transformation & Optimisation (Primary Focus)

  • Leading end‑to‑end analysis of cross‑functional business processes to identify inefficiencies, duplication, control gaps, and operational risks.
  • Documenting current‑state processes using structured modelling standards such as BPMN.
  • Designing future‑state processes aligned to strategic goals, regulatory requirements, and performance targets.
  • Applying Lean, Six Sigma, and value‑stream methodologies to drive measurable cycle‑time reduction, cost optimization, and quality uplift.
  • Establishing process ownership models, governance structures, and performance metrics.
  • Building and maintaining a structured process inventory and control framework.
  • Tracking and reporting measurable improvement outcomes to ensure sustained benefits realisation.

Performance & Data‑Driven Insight

  • Defining operational KPIs aligned to strategic and process objectives.
  • Using data‑driven analysis to diagnose root causes and validate improvement hypotheses.
  • Supporting development of performance dashboards and management reporting.
  • Partnering with business leaders to monitor and refine process performance.

Requirements & Change Enablement (Supporting Focus)

  • Translating process improvements into clear functional and non‑functional system requirements.
  • Facilitating discovery workshops to eliminate ambiguity and streamline workflows.
  • Ensuring technology solutions align to agreed future‑state processes.
  • Conducting change impact assessments related to process redesign and operating model changes.
  • Supporting stakeholder adoption through documentation, training, and governance enablement.

About Corpay

Corpay is a global technology organisation that is leading the future of commercial payments with a culture of innovation that drives us to constantly create new and better ways to pay. Our specialized payment solutions help businesses control, simplify, and secure payment for fuel, general payables, toll and lodging expenses. Millions of people in over 80 countries around the world use our solutions for their payments.
